How to Get a Mercedes Key Fob Replacement

If you own a Mercedes you're aware of how important your key fob is to the security of your vehicle. It could be necessary to replace it if lost or stolen, or if it is damaged.

Typically the cost to get a key fob for a Mercedes replaced could range from $200 to $700 depending on the model and year. There is a simpler and more affordable alternative to visiting the dealership.

Battery

If you own a mercedes car key replacement key fob, it's crucial to change its battery regularly to ensure that it's functioning. This will ensure that you're able use your keys for whatever they were intended to do and keep your car safe.

The process of replacing the battery on your Mercedes-Benz key fob is relatively easy. You can do it yourself or bring your vehicle into the dealer to get assistance. If you choose to replace the battery on your own, you'll require a flat-tipped screwdriver.

First, identify the type of key that you have. There are two types of keys The Chrome Key (encased in metal) and the Smart Key. The Chrome Key only needs one CR 2025 battery, while the Smart Key requires two.

No matter what key you own and what you are using it for, the steps to replace the battery are the same to pull the latch at the bottom of the casing for the key and stick the key horizontally into the slot, and lift the compartment for the battery out to replace the batteries.

Once you have replaced the batteries, you are able to restore your key. It should only take some minutes.

Programming

Key fobs have become increasingly popular in modern vehicles because of its convenience as well as the ability to unlock and lock doors and trunks without the need for keys. The devices can fail or become defective. This can lead to serious problems and cause the device to not function effectively.

The key fob contains tiny transponders or chips which transmits signals to your vehicle's immobilizer system. The engine control module will not allow the vehicle to start if the signals are incorrect.

Fortunately, there are few steps you can take to address this issue yourself. First, you must ensure that the batteries inside your key fob are not exhausted.

You should also examine your fuse box to ensure that there aren't any fuses blowing. A fuse that is blown could cause your Mercedes key fob to stop working.

After you have checked the fuse, make sure that you replace them with the same ampere rating.

In the end, you must insert your key into the ignition and turn it to the "ON" position. This will activate the electrical system of your vehicle and allow your Mercedes key fob to enter programming mode.

Your Mercedes key fob will chirp when it enters program mode. Once you hear this chirp, press and release the "Unlock" and "Lock" buttons until the door locks are engaged or disengage.

The chirps will last for around 30 seconds. During this time, the new key fob will be inserted into the security system in your vehicle.
